CardioRender

Ongoing project

Interactive 3D cardiac simulators for teaching

A growing set of browser-based tools built to teach cardiac anatomy the way it is actually encountered in the lab — segmented coronary anatomy with interactive occlusion and matched 12-lead ECG, the conduction system, echocardiographic views, and catheter mechanics. Built for DM Cardiology trainees and cath lab teaching.

Research, grants & IP

Co-Principal Investigator

Design and development of a comprehensive low-cost simulation lab

Advanced cardiopulmonary resuscitation, respiratory system, vascular access, critical care, interventional catheterisation and ultrasound training. Funded by the SreePVF Foundation.

₹1 CroreFunding
SreePVFFunding agency
